If you read wine reviews, you are already either amused or confused by the soaring language wine writers often use to describe what they are smelling and tasting. But do you always know what they mean? If not, you are in for a treat because there’s no other book in the English-speaking world quite like this. The author, a lifelong lover of both wine and words, has compiled this unique thesaurus of 36,975 wine tasting descriptors into 20 special collections extracted from 27 categories so you can locate exactly the right term or phrase to express yourself clearly or to understand others.
